Baseball Sweeps Home Opener From CU

DURANT, Okla. – Southeastern bounced back from its opening weekend and opened the home schedule in style with a double-header sweep of Cameron on Saturday afternoon at The Ballpark in Durant.
 
The Savage Storm took game one in a run-rule 12-1 before finishing off the twinbill with a 4-3 victory.
 
The wins lift SE to 3-2 on the season heading into an out-of-conference midweek matchup on Feb. 10 with Oklahoma Christian starting at noon at The Ballpark in Durant.
 
Corban Taylor, Collin Sefcik and Jacob Soisson each tallied a pair of hits in game one, while five others each added one and the Storm outhit the Aggies 11-to-2.
 
Coats drove in three runs in the game, while Kaleb Thomas and Soisson each added a pair of RBI, with one of Soisson's coming on a solo homer.
 
Evan Sanders got the start and the win as he allowed a run on two hits over 5.0 innings pitched with nine strikeouts to move to 1-0 on the season.
 
Bryce Clemons tossed the final 2.0 innings and struck out two while facing the minimum number of batters.
 
A Brandon Grimsley single would plate Thomas in the bottom of the first to open scoring.
 
In the second inning the Storm found its groove with Thomas drawing a bases-loaded walk to plate the first run of the inning, followed by a Coats three-run double and an RBI single by Taylor to open up a 6-0 advantage after two innings.
 
CU would tack on a run in the top of the third, but SE would answer back with another one in the bottom of the third on a Soisson sac fly that plated Sefcik.
 
Soisson would connect on a solo homer to right in the fifth.
 
Dylan Helms would plate a run in the bottom of the sixth, and would score later in the inning on an error by the CU shortstop.  SE would finish scoring in the sixth when Thomas reached on a fielder's choice which plated Logan Terwilliger for a 12-1 win.
 
In game two SE continued to outhit the Aggies, this time by an 8-to-2 margin, but three Storm errors would keep the game close.
 
Thomas would score in the first thanks to an error, and would drive in Soisson in the second for a 2-0 lead.
 
That edge stretched to 3-0 on a Grimsley groundout that plated Soisson.
 
CU would answer with three runs in the fifth thanks to a pair of errors and a double to knot the game at 3-3.
 
However, Terwilliger would answer in the bottom half of the fifth with an RBI single that scored Burcham and held to be the winning run.
 
Terwilliger was the only SE hitter with multiple hits in the game, finishing 2-for-3 with an RBI.
 
Thomas and Grimsley each added an RBI as well.
 
Dylan Linke got the start but was hit with his second-straight no decision after allowing three runs, just one earned, on two hits with four strikeouts in 4.2 innings pitched.
 
For the second-straight weekend Brady Colbert would get the win in relief of Linke after facing the minimum in 2.1 innings with a pair of K's.
